Walmart Canada · 6 days ago
(USA) Software Engineer III - React/GraphQL development
Walmart Inc. is the world’s largest retailer, and they are seeking a Senior Software Engineer to join their International Digital Experiences team. The role involves building reusable React components, optimizing performance, and collaborating with product, design, and UX teams to enhance the online shopping experience for customers across different countries.
DeliveryRetailShopping
Responsibilities
Build reusable React components with modular CSS, manage data on the client with Redux, use react query, and GraphQL
Measure and resolve performance bottlenecks, using tools like Chrome DevTools, Lighthouse, WebPagetest, or custom tooling
Refactor or improve existing code. We constantly find ways to improve all of our JavaScript code and you are all aboard
Work closely with our product, design, and UX teams to create amazing and intuitive experiences that make it effortless to connect different apps together
Help put tools, processes, and documentation in place to improve our code quality
Demonstrate technical expertise in solving challenging programming and design problems
Review code written by other team members or other teams
Ship to hundreds of thousands of users every day while having lots of autonomy in terms of code and feature ownership
Help out with our Node-based developer platform
Share what you know and learn either one-on-one or with lightning talks to the group
Work boldly with a sense of urgency; embrace mistakes, learn from them, and drive the team toward success
Qualification
Required
4+ years of experience in object-oriented design and software development
4+ years of experience in building responsive, single page web applications using modern front-end JavaScript technologies like React, Angular, Vue, etc
Thorough understanding of React, Node.JS and its core principles
4+ years of experience in creating and/or consuming RESTful web services
Excellent communication skills: Demonstrated ability to explain complex technical issues to both technical and non-technical audiences
Expertise with unit testing & Test-Driven Development (TDD)
BS/MS in computer science or equivalent work experience
Option 1: Bachelor's degree in computer science, computer engineering, computer information systems, software engineering, or related area and 2 years' experience in software engineering or related area
Option 2: 4 years' experience in software engineering or related area
Preferred
Master's degree in Computer Science, Computer Engineering, Computer Information Systems, Software Engineering, or related area
Background in creating inclusive digital experiences
Demonstrating knowledge in implementing Web Content Accessibility Guidelines (WCAG) 2.2 AA standards
Knowledge of assistive technologies
Integrating digital accessibility seamlessly
Knowledge of accessibility best practices
Benefits
401(k) match
Stock purchase plan
Paid maternity and parental leave
PTO
Multiple health plans
Medical, vision and dental coverage
Company-paid life insurance
Short-term and long-term disability
Company discounts
Military Leave Pay
Adoption and surrogacy expense reimbursement
Live Better U is a Walmart-paid education benefit program
Company
Walmart Canada
Walmart Canada is a subsidiary of Walmart that operates a chain of more than 400 stores nationwide. It is a sub-organization of Walmart.
Funding
Current Stage
Late StageRecent News
Canada NewsWire
2025-12-18
Canada NewsWire
2025-12-03
Company data provided by crunchbase